6-(4'-Hydroxyphenoxy)-1-hexene is a chemical compound characterized by the molecular formula C12H16O2. It is a hexene derivative featuring a hydroxyphenoxy group attached to the sixth carbon atom. 6-(4'-Hydroxyphenoxy)-1-hexene is distinguished by its unique chemical properties, conferred by the hydroxyphenoxy group, which makes it valuable in a range of chemical reactions and processes. Its versatility is further highlighted by its applications in organic synthesis, industrial product manufacturing, and the exploration of its potential in pharmaceutical and medicinal fields.

Check Digit Verification of cas no

The CAS Registry Mumber 85234-58-8 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 8,5,2,3 and 4 respectively; the second part has 2 digits, 5 and 8 respectively.
Calculate Digit Verification of CAS Registry Number 85234-58:
(7*8)+(6*5)+(5*2)+(4*3)+(3*4)+(2*5)+(1*8)=138
138 % 10 = 8
So 85234-58-8 is a valid CAS Registry Number.

85234-58-8Relevant academic research and scientific papers

Liquid Crystalline Asymmetric Bisphenyl-4,4'-bibenzyldicarboxylates and Polysiloxanes with Bisphenyl-4,4'-bibenzyldicarboxylat Components in the Side Chains, Synthesis and Characterization

Boberg, Friedrich,Mueller, Enno,Reddig, Wolfram

, p. 136 - 142 (2007/10/02)

Asymmetric bisphenyl bibenzyl-4,4'-dicarboxylates with an alkenyloxy- or the 10-undecenoylgroup in the p-position of one terminal benzene ring and the butyl-, an alkoxy- or the thiomethylgroup in the p-position of the other terminal benzene ring (12-14) are synthesized.The olefins 12-14 are added to a poly(methylhydrogensiloxane) 15 to give mesomorphic side chain polysiloxanes 16-18.Data of liquid crystalline properties of 12-14, 16-18 and precursors are discussed.
